The term _____ is used for a person possessing two different alleles
tigry1 [53]
<span>Heterozygous would be the correct term. This takes place when a pair of genes has one dominant and one recessive trait, meaning they are different. The prefix to the word heterozygous is hetero- , which specifically indicates that things are different.</span>

The ____ must make long-term decisions about where the organization is headed and how it will operate, and has ultimate responsi
dusya [7]

The C.E.O must make long-term decisions about where the organization is headed and how it will operate, and has  responsibility for strategic planning.

<h3>Who is the CEO?</h3>

This is an acronym and the full meaning is Chief Executive Officer. It is the highest ranking officer in an organization. The CEO oversees other positions to ensure that the organization is running as planned.

He drives the profitability of the business and he is also the one that has to implement and carry out the key aspects of the business that is in question.
